SOFTWARE FOR SERVICE COMPANIES is revolutionizing the way service businesses operate, offering a suite of tools designed to streamline operations, enhance customer satisfaction, and drive growth. Gone are the days of clunky, outdated software solutions; modern, cloud-based platforms empower service companies with real-time insights, automated workflows, and seamless integration with existing systems.
This shift towards digital transformation is reshaping the service industry, enabling businesses to adapt to changing market demands and stay ahead of the competition.
The evolution of software for service companies is a fascinating story of innovation and adaptation. Early software solutions were often limited in scope and functionality, focusing primarily on basic tasks like scheduling and billing. However, with the advent of cloud computing and advancements in artificial intelligence, modern platforms have become sophisticated, offering a comprehensive range of features designed to address the unique needs of service businesses.
From managing customer relationships and optimizing field operations to automating accounting processes and generating insightful data reports, software is playing a pivotal role in empowering service companies to achieve their full potential.
The Evolution of Software for Service Companies
The service industry, encompassing a vast array of sectors like healthcare, education, and consulting, has undergone a significant transformation with the advent and evolution of software solutions specifically designed for service businesses. From rudimentary tools to sophisticated cloud-based platforms, software has played a pivotal role in streamlining operations, enhancing customer experiences, and driving growth within service organizations.
Early Software Solutions: Laying the Foundation
The early days of software for service companies were marked by simple, on-premise solutions that focused on automating basic tasks such as scheduling, invoicing, and customer management. These solutions were often limited in their functionality, requiring manual data entry and lacking the integration capabilities of modern platforms.
Despite their limitations, early software solutions paved the way for the development of more comprehensive and advanced tools.
Software for service companies needs to be versatile and efficient to manage customer interactions across various channels. A crucial aspect of this is incorporating CRM with text messaging , which allows for quick and personalized communication, enhancing customer satisfaction and loyalty.
By seamlessly integrating text messaging into their CRM systems, service companies can streamline operations, improve response times, and build stronger relationships with their clients.
- Basic Scheduling and Appointment Management:Early software solutions offered rudimentary scheduling and appointment management capabilities. These tools allowed service providers to track appointments, manage calendars, and send reminders to clients. However, they lacked the flexibility and real-time integration found in modern platforms.
- Invoice Generation and Payment Processing:Early software solutions also included basic invoice generation and payment processing features. These tools enabled service providers to create invoices, track payments, and manage accounts receivable. However, they were often limited to simple invoices and lacked the advanced reporting and analytics capabilities of modern solutions.
Software for service companies often requires specialized features to track time, projects, and client interactions. A robust accounting system is essential, and ERP ACCOUNTING SOFTWARE can streamline these processes by integrating financial data with other critical aspects of the business, such as customer relationship management (CRM) and project management.
This integration helps service companies gain a holistic view of their operations, improving efficiency and profitability.
- Customer Relationship Management (CRM):Early CRM systems were basic, often focusing on contact management and basic communication features. These solutions lacked the advanced analytics, automation, and marketing capabilities of modern CRM platforms. They provided a rudimentary framework for managing customer interactions but lacked the comprehensive insights and automation features available today.
Core Features of Software for Service Companies
Software designed for service companies needs to handle the unique challenges of this industry. Unlike manufacturing or retail, service businesses often deal with complex projects, diverse client needs, and a high degree of customization. As a result, service-specific software must offer features that streamline these processes, improve efficiency, and enhance customer satisfaction.
Essential Features of Service Software
The core functionality of software for service companies is centered around managing projects, tracking time and expenses, and enhancing communication and collaboration. Here are some essential features that define this type of software:
Feature | Description | Benefits | Examples |
---|---|---|---|
Project Management | Provides tools to plan, track, and manage projects from initiation to completion. Features include task management, scheduling, resource allocation, and progress tracking. | Improved project visibility, enhanced collaboration, reduced delays, and increased efficiency. | Asana, Trello, Monday.com |
Time Tracking | Allows users to record time spent on projects, tasks, or clients. Features include time logs, automatic time tracking, and integration with project management tools. | Accurate billing, improved productivity, and better resource allocation. | Toggl Track, Clockify, Timely |
Expense Management | Facilitates the tracking and management of expenses related to projects or clients. Features include expense reporting, approval workflows, and integration with accounting software. | Improved financial control, reduced errors, and streamlined expense reporting. | Expensify, Zoho Expense, QuickBooks Self-Employed |
Customer Relationship Management (CRM) | Manages interactions with customers and prospects. Features include contact management, communication tools, and sales pipeline tracking. | Enhanced customer engagement, improved communication, and increased sales opportunities. | Salesforce, HubSpot CRM, Zoho CRM |
Reporting and Analytics | Provides insights into project performance, financial data, and customer behavior. Features include customizable dashboards, data visualization tools, and reporting capabilities. | Data-driven decision making, improved efficiency, and enhanced performance tracking. | Google Analytics, Tableau, Power BI |
Integration with Other Tools | Connects with other software applications used by the business, such as accounting software, payment gateways, and communication platforms. | Streamlined workflows, reduced data entry, and improved efficiency. | Zapier, Integromat, Microsoft Power Automate |
Benefits of Implementing Software for Service Companies
Service companies, from consulting firms to healthcare providers, face unique challenges in managing their operations and delivering exceptional customer experiences. Implementing software solutions tailored for their specific needs can be a game-changer, unlocking a range of benefits that drive efficiency, enhance customer satisfaction, and empower data-driven decision-making.
Increased Efficiency
Software solutions for service companies automate repetitive tasks, streamline workflows, and eliminate manual processes, leading to significant time and resource savings. By centralizing data, automating scheduling, and simplifying communication, these solutions empower service providers to work smarter, not harder.
- Streamlined Scheduling and Resource Allocation:Software solutions automate scheduling, resource allocation, and appointment management, ensuring optimal utilization of resources and minimizing downtime.
- Automated Task Management:Service providers can assign, track, and manage tasks efficiently, reducing the risk of missed deadlines and improving overall project management.
- Simplified Communication and Collaboration:Integrated communication tools within software solutions facilitate seamless collaboration among team members, clients, and partners, improving communication flow and reducing misunderstandings.
Improved Customer Satisfaction
Software solutions empower service companies to provide personalized and efficient service, leading to higher customer satisfaction and loyalty. By leveraging data insights and automating customer interactions, service providers can deliver a superior customer experience.
- Personalized Service:Software solutions enable service companies to gather and analyze customer data, allowing them to provide personalized recommendations, tailored solutions, and proactive support.
- Improved Communication and Responsiveness:Software solutions streamline communication channels, ensuring prompt responses to customer inquiries and requests, fostering trust and loyalty.
- Enhanced Transparency and Accountability:Service providers can track progress, provide real-time updates, and maintain clear communication with clients, building confidence and trust in their services.
Enhanced Data Insights
Software solutions for service companies provide valuable data insights, enabling data-driven decision-making and continuous improvement. By tracking key performance indicators (KPIs), analyzing customer behavior, and identifying trends, service companies can optimize their operations and achieve better business outcomes.
- Real-time Performance Tracking:Software solutions provide dashboards and reports that track key metrics, enabling service companies to monitor performance, identify bottlenecks, and make informed decisions.
- Customer Behavior Analysis:By analyzing customer data, service companies can understand customer preferences, identify areas for improvement, and personalize their offerings to meet specific needs.
- Trend Forecasting and Predictive Analytics:Software solutions can analyze historical data to identify patterns and predict future trends, enabling service companies to proactively address challenges and capitalize on opportunities.
Streamlined Operations
Software solutions simplify and streamline operations, eliminating manual processes, reducing errors, and improving overall efficiency. By automating tasks, centralizing data, and improving communication, these solutions create a more efficient and organized service environment.
While software for service companies often focuses on managing customer interactions and projects, the world of manufacturing relies heavily on MANUFACTURING ERP SOFTWARE to streamline production, inventory, and supply chain operations. Understanding the unique needs of each industry is crucial for choosing the right software solution, as both service and manufacturing companies have distinct requirements for success.
- Automated Workflows:Software solutions automate repetitive tasks and workflows, freeing up time for service providers to focus on high-value activities.
- Centralized Data Management:Software solutions provide a central repository for all relevant data, ensuring data accuracy, accessibility, and consistency across the organization.
- Improved Reporting and Analytics:Software solutions generate comprehensive reports and analytics, providing valuable insights into operational performance, customer behavior, and financial health.
Types of Software for Service Companies
Service companies rely on specialized software to manage their operations efficiently and deliver exceptional customer experiences. These software solutions cater to specific needs, streamlining workflows, automating tasks, and providing valuable insights. Understanding the different types of software available is crucial for choosing the right tools to optimize your service business.
Customer Relationship Management (CRM)
CRM software is designed to manage customer interactions and data. It centralizes customer information, including contact details, communication history, purchase records, and feedback. This comprehensive view enables service companies to personalize interactions, anticipate customer needs, and improve overall customer satisfaction.
CRM systems offer a range of features, including:
- Contact management:Organizing and managing customer information, such as contact details, addresses, and communication preferences.
- Sales automation:Automating sales processes, such as lead generation, qualification, and opportunity management.
- Marketing automation:Automating marketing campaigns, including email marketing, social media marketing, and targeted advertising.
- Customer support:Managing customer inquiries, resolving issues, and providing technical support.
- Reporting and analytics:Tracking customer engagement, analyzing sales performance, and identifying areas for improvement.
Examples of popular CRM systems include Salesforce, HubSpot, and Zoho CRM.
Choosing the Right Software for Your Service Company
Selecting the right software for your service company is crucial for optimizing operations, improving efficiency, and enhancing customer satisfaction. A well-chosen software solution can streamline processes, automate tasks, and provide valuable insights into your business performance. However, navigating the vast array of software options available can be overwhelming.
This section Artikels key factors to consider when making this critical decision, along with a decision-making framework to guide you through the process.
Factors to Consider
To choose the right software, consider the following key factors:
Business Size and Complexity
The size and complexity of your service business significantly impact your software needs. Small businesses with a simple service offering might benefit from a basic software solution, while larger enterprises with diverse services and complex workflows require more comprehensive and scalable software.
Industry-Specific Needs
Different service industries have unique requirements. For instance, a software solution for a consulting firm will differ from one for a healthcare provider. Consider industry-specific features, regulations, and compliance requirements when selecting software.
Budget and Resources
Software costs vary widely depending on features, functionality, and licensing models. Determine your budget and resource availability before evaluating potential software options. Consider the long-term cost of ownership, including implementation, training, and ongoing support.
Integration Capabilities
Your chosen software should seamlessly integrate with existing systems and tools, such as accounting software, CRM, and project management platforms. Poor integration can lead to data silos, inefficiencies, and increased workload.
Decision-Making Framework
A structured decision-making framework can help you choose the right software for your service company:
1. Define Your Needs
Start by clearly defining your business objectives and the specific challenges you aim to address with software. This will help you narrow down your search and focus on solutions that meet your requirements.
2. Research and Evaluate Options
Explore different software solutions available in the market. Consider features, functionality, pricing, user reviews, and industry reputation. Conduct demos and trials to gain firsthand experience with the software.
3. Consider Long-Term Costs
Evaluate the total cost of ownership, including initial purchase, implementation, training, ongoing support, and potential upgrades. Consider the long-term value and ROI of each software option.
4. Seek Expert Advice
Consult with industry experts, software consultants, or other service companies that have successfully implemented similar software solutions. Their insights can provide valuable guidance and help you avoid common pitfalls.
5. Make a Decision
Based on your needs, research, and expert advice, choose the software that best aligns with your business objectives, budget, and resources.
Software for service companies needs to be robust and adaptable to manage diverse client needs and projects. KLAVIYO CRM offers a unique approach by focusing on customer segmentation and targeted communication, which can be invaluable for service companies seeking to personalize their offerings and improve client engagement.
6. Implement and Train
Once you select a software solution, implement it effectively and provide comprehensive training to your team. This ensures smooth adoption and maximizes the benefits of the software.
Case Studies of Software Implementation in Service Companies
Software for service companies has become a necessity for businesses to streamline operations, enhance customer satisfaction, and drive growth. Numerous companies across various industries have successfully implemented software solutions, transforming their service delivery models and achieving remarkable results. Examining these case studies provides valuable insights into the challenges, solutions, and impacts of software implementation in service businesses.
Successful Software Implementations in Service Businesses, SOFTWARE FOR SERVICE COMPANIES
Examining successful software implementations in service businesses reveals the transformative power of technology in enhancing operations, customer satisfaction, and overall success. Here are some notable examples:
- Customer Relationship Management (CRM) for a Marketing Agency:A leading marketing agency implemented a CRM system to centralize customer data, track marketing campaigns, and personalize client interactions. The CRM software enabled the agency to manage leads effectively, automate tasks, and gain insights into customer behavior, leading to improved campaign performance and increased client retention.
- Field Service Management (FSM) for a Home Repair Company:A home repair company adopted an FSM solution to optimize field technician scheduling, track work orders, and provide real-time updates to customers. The FSM software enabled the company to reduce response times, improve service efficiency, and enhance customer communication, resulting in higher customer satisfaction and increased revenue.
Software for service companies often focuses on streamlining operations, managing customer interactions, and tracking financials. However, industries like construction require a more specialized approach. CONSTRUCTION ERP systems are specifically designed to handle the unique challenges of the construction industry, including project management, resource allocation, and cost control.
By leveraging these specialized solutions, service companies in the construction sector can achieve greater efficiency and profitability.
- Project Management Software for a Consulting Firm:A consulting firm implemented project management software to streamline project planning, track progress, and facilitate collaboration among team members. The software enabled the firm to improve project visibility, manage resources effectively, and enhance communication, leading to increased project efficiency and client satisfaction.
Challenges and Solutions During Software Implementation
Implementing software in a service company presents unique challenges that require careful planning and execution. Here are some common challenges and their potential solutions:
- Resistance to Change:Employees may resist adopting new software, fearing it will disrupt their existing workflows or require additional training. Addressing this challenge requires effective communication, training programs, and demonstrating the benefits of the software.
- Data Integration:Integrating existing data from multiple systems into the new software can be a complex and time-consuming process. Implementing data migration strategies, data cleansing procedures, and leveraging data integration tools can streamline this process.
- Customization and Configuration:Service companies often have unique business processes that require software customization. Identifying these specific needs and working with software vendors to tailor the solution can ensure successful implementation.
Impact of Software on Company Operations and Success
Successful software implementations can have a significant impact on a service company’s operations and overall success. Here are some key benefits:
- Improved Efficiency and Productivity:Software solutions automate tasks, streamline workflows, and provide real-time insights, leading to increased efficiency and productivity.
- Enhanced Customer Satisfaction:Software can improve communication, provide personalized service, and ensure timely delivery, leading to higher customer satisfaction and loyalty.
- Increased Revenue and Profitability:By improving efficiency, reducing costs, and enhancing customer satisfaction, software can contribute to increased revenue and profitability.
The Future of Software for Service Companies
The software landscape for service companies is constantly evolving, driven by advancements in technology and the changing needs of businesses. Emerging trends and technologies are reshaping how service companies operate, impacting the features and capabilities of software solutions designed for their specific needs.
The Impact of AI, ML, and Automation
Artificial intelligence (AI), machine learning (ML), and automation are transforming service operations by automating tasks, improving efficiency, and enhancing customer experiences. These technologies are poised to play a significant role in shaping the future of software for service companies.
- AI-powered chatbots and virtual assistantsare becoming increasingly sophisticated, enabling service companies to provide 24/7 customer support, answer frequently asked questions, and resolve simple issues without human intervention. This reduces response times, improves customer satisfaction, and frees up human agents to focus on more complex tasks.
- ML algorithmscan analyze customer data to identify patterns and predict future behavior, enabling service companies to personalize their offerings, anticipate customer needs, and proactively address potential issues. This leads to improved customer retention and loyalty.
- Automationis streamlining repetitive tasks, such as scheduling appointments, generating reports, and processing invoices, freeing up employees to focus on more strategic activities. This increases productivity, reduces errors, and improves overall efficiency.
The Rise of Cloud-Based Software
Cloud-based software solutions are gaining popularity among service companies due to their scalability, affordability, and accessibility. These solutions allow businesses to access their data and applications from anywhere, anytime, using any device, making them ideal for mobile workforces.
- Cloud-based softwareoffers a flexible and scalable infrastructure, allowing service companies to easily adjust their resources as their needs change. This eliminates the need for costly hardware investments and reduces the burden of IT maintenance.
- Cloud-based solutionsare often more affordable than traditional on-premises software, as they eliminate the need for upfront investments in hardware and software licenses. Instead, businesses pay a monthly subscription fee based on their usage.
- Cloud-based softwareis accessible from any device with an internet connection, making it ideal for service companies with mobile workforces. Employees can access their data and applications from anywhere, anytime, enabling them to work remotely and stay connected.
Integration with Other Business Systems
Software for service companies is increasingly being integrated with other business systems, such as CRM, ERP, and accounting software, to create a seamless and unified platform for managing operations. This integration allows businesses to access a single source of truth for all their data, improving decision-making and streamlining processes.
- Integration with CRM systemsenables service companies to manage customer interactions, track sales opportunities, and improve customer service. This allows businesses to provide personalized experiences and build stronger relationships with their customers.
- Integration with ERP systemsallows service companies to manage their inventory, track expenses, and automate financial processes. This improves efficiency, reduces errors, and provides real-time insights into business performance.
- Integration with accounting softwareallows service companies to automate invoicing, track payments, and generate financial reports. This simplifies accounting processes, reduces errors, and improves financial transparency.
The Future of Software for Service Companies
Software for service companies is expected to continue evolving, becoming more intelligent, automated, and integrated with other business systems. The focus will be on providing businesses with the tools they need to improve efficiency, enhance customer experiences, and drive growth.
- AI and ML will play an even more significant rolein service operations, automating tasks, personalizing experiences, and providing predictive insights. This will allow businesses to optimize their operations, anticipate customer needs, and make data-driven decisions.
- Cloud-based software solutions will continue to dominate the market, offering flexibility, scalability, and affordability. This will enable service companies to adapt to changing market conditions and scale their operations quickly and efficiently.
- Integration with other business systems will become increasingly important, creating a unified platform for managing all aspects of the business. This will improve data visibility, streamline processes, and enable better decision-making.
Concluding Remarks
In conclusion, SOFTWARE FOR SERVICE COMPANIES has become an indispensable tool for service businesses seeking to thrive in today’s competitive landscape. By leveraging the power of technology, service companies can optimize their operations, enhance customer experiences, and unlock new opportunities for growth.
The future of software for service companies is bright, with exciting advancements in artificial intelligence, machine learning, and automation poised to further revolutionize the industry. As technology continues to evolve, service businesses that embrace innovative software solutions will be well-positioned to stay ahead of the curve and achieve lasting success.
Answers to Common Questions: SOFTWARE FOR SERVICE COMPANIES
What are the key benefits of using software for service companies?
Software for service companies offers numerous benefits, including increased efficiency, improved customer satisfaction, enhanced data insights, and streamlined operations. By automating tasks, centralizing information, and providing real-time visibility into business performance, these platforms empower service businesses to operate more effectively and deliver exceptional customer experiences.
How do I choose the right software for my service company?
Selecting the right software for your service company requires careful consideration of your specific needs and priorities. Factors to consider include business size and complexity, industry-specific requirements, budget and resources, and integration capabilities. It’s essential to research different platforms, compare features and pricing, and seek recommendations from other service businesses.
What are some examples of successful software implementations in service companies?
Many service companies have successfully implemented software solutions to improve their operations and achieve significant results. For example, a field service company might utilize software to optimize technician scheduling, track inventory, and manage customer appointments, leading to improved efficiency and customer satisfaction.
A consulting firm might leverage software to manage projects, track time and expenses, and collaborate with clients, resulting in enhanced productivity and better client outcomes.